Risk Roundtable Discussion and Networking Happy Hour

Join GRF’s risk advisory experts and AHT Insurance for a can’t-miss roundtable discussion on organizational risk and strategy. Roundtable attendees will come away with the tools and fundamentals they need to revisit their current risk mitigation strategy and plan for the future.

The event will kick off with an engaging panel discussion among industry pioneers on the emerging risks affecting some of the NY metro area’s most prominent enterprises. Attendees are encouraged to share their own challenges while engaging in an interactive roundtable discussion with our speakers and their own peers. Following the formal program, participants are invited to continue the discussion in a breakout format during a casual happy hour.

Featured Speakers

Richard Muzikar is an Enterprise Risk Management Advisor for Long Island Power Authority. Mr. Muzikar is responsible for developing and implementing LIPA’s Enterprise Risk Management Program in conjunction with Public Service Enterprise Group (PSEG) Long Island. Previously, Mr. Muzikar served as Director of Enterprise Risk Management for the Consolidated Edison Company (Con Edison) in New York City where he spent 40 years of his career. At Con Edison, Mr. Muzikar developed and implemented the company’s Enterprise Risk Management Program while serving on the ERM Advisory Boards of North Carolina State and St. John’s Universities.

Mark Pappas is the Executive Vice President and Chief Risk Officer for Amalgamated Bank. Mr. Pappas joined Amalgamated Bank in 2015 as the Chief Audit Executive. He spent 3 years in this role before being appointed Chief Risk Officer in May of 2018. Prior to joining Amalgamated Bank, Mr. Pappas held various Internal Audit and Finance Risk executive leadership roles at Morgan Stanley over an 11 year period. While at Morgan Stanley, he developed and implemented the global, firm wide Sarbanes-Oxley compliance program.
